Dipdap is a British children's television series on CBeebies, in which a drawn line creates endless challenges and surprises for the unsuspecting little character Dipdap.

In 2012, it was reported that the show would not return for a second series.

The series was created by Steve Roberts and produced by Ragdoll Worldwide, the joint venture of Ragdoll Productions and BBC Worldwide.

Broadcast

The series aired on CBeebies in the United Kingdom. In Canada, The series was broadcast on TFO.

Awards

Dipdap won the 2011 British Academy Children's Award in the "Short Form" category.[2][3]
